In this role, you will perform high-quality ultrasound procedures across general radiology and cardiology disciplines, including ER, ICU, Peds, PICU, and portable imaging. You will operate state-of-the-art GE ultrasound machines, utilize PACS systems, and ensure accurate and timely imaging results. Flexibility is essential, as you will rotate through on-call duties, weekend shifts, and may be assigned to emergency or relief teams to respond to urgent needs. Your efforts will directly support hospital teams during critical moments, ensuring optimal patient outcomes.
Required Skills:
ARDMS or ARRT(S) certification
BLS certification
Minimum of 2 years of ultrasound experience
Proven experience working in ER, ICU, Peds, PICU, and portable imaging
EPIC system experience
Proficiency with GE ultrasound equipment and PACS
Strong attention to detail and excellent communication skills
Ability to work independently and as part of a team
Flexibility to rotate on-call and weekend shifts

VieMed is a great workplace where every employee is valued and protected as a member of the VieMed family. We are aware of a common scam where fake company positions/jobs are posted online.
VieMed and its subsidiaries regularly post opportunities on various job and social media sites. All opportunities are also posted on our companies corporate careers pages. If a job board posting or direct outreach is not found on one of our official websites, it may be deceptive or expired and could be a scam. Our official websites with our career pages are located at viemed.com, viemedstaffing.com, and hmpinc.net.
We strongly encourage you to submit your application directly through our official website(s).
At VieMed, we prioritize your privacy and security. We do not require or ask for a driver’s license, social security number, passport number, credit card, or bank information during our interview process.
We do not email from personal accounts (e.g., Gmail, Yahoo, Hotmail) always look for our official email addresses: @viemed.com, @viemedstaffing.com, or @hmpinc.net.
We do not ask you for any upfront payment, such as fees for application processing, background checks, training materials, visa processing, or medical equipment. We do not send applicants electronic funds in connection with our application process.
The FTC has additional resources to help you spot job scams. If you spot a scam, report it to ReportFraud.ftc.gov at ReportFraud.ftc.gov
